Tottenham Hotspur goalkeeper Carlo Cudicini has broken both of his wrists in a motorbike crash in London on Thursday morning.

The 36-year-old former Chelsea gloveman was injured in a collision with a Ford Fiesta in Walthamstow.

A police spokesperson confirmed: "A 36-year-old male suffered injuries described as possibly life-changing and was taken to an East London hospital for further assessment and treatment."

A statement from Spurs added: "Carlo Cudicini has fractured his wrists and injured his pelvis after being involved in a road accident this morning.

"The 36-year-old Italian goalkeeper has been admitted to hospital and undergone scans under the supervision of club medical staff.

"The club will update supporters on Carlo as soon as there is any further information."

Cudicini moved to White Hart Lane in January this year and has so far made 12 appearances for the north London club.
